                    Hi, I just saw your post. My kids go to Creative Horizons too and yes, they do creative writing. They focus on skills for creative writing like characterisation, setting and vivid vocab. Plot structures and the planning process is covered too.

                    One thing I like is that they DON’T just give word lists to the kids which I think makes them dependent on them. Then in school, they are lost when they aren’t provided word lists. The good part is they know what goes into making a compo an interesting one. The plot can be simple but the story is really narrated to capture interest.
